Iwas brought up in and for some years after I married, in Coulsdon, Surrey. Good transport to London and the coast and the countryside..Plenty of clubs etc. Moved to a village near Basingstoke early 60s and loved it. Large garden and plenty of activities.When my husband had to take early retirement owing to ill health we had to move to a cheaper property in a Norfolk village. Hated it. So let the bungalow and travelled Europe by caravan for ten years until husband died and I had to come back after spending two years in Spain. I could not afford to move back to Hampshire or to run a car. It was not too bad while I was active but now I am more or less housebound (arthritis) I can only get out once a week shopping and don't see anyone apart from my help. Although Iam on an estate it is so quiet. Few people pass by. Go out in their cars and then shut themselves indoors.
Many years ago when I was working in London one of the employees was retiring I asked him if he was moving. He said he was retiring in Tooting. Cinemas, theatres, good transport meant he didn't need car, etc.
